Sodium Hydrogen Carbonate vs. Sodium Bicarbonate: Clearing Up the Confusion

One Substance, Many Names

People who enjoy baking or handle household cleaning products have likely seen both “sodium hydrogen carbonate” and “sodium bicarbonate” on ingredient labels. A lot of folks wonder whether these two names signal different ingredients or different uses. It’s easy to see why: science gives things more than one name for the same reason the grocery store puts “soda,” “pop,” and “cola” on different shelves. These names describe the same chemical: NaHCO3, a white powder that pops up everywhere from kitchen pantries to fire extinguishers.

On one hand, “sodium hydrogen carbonate” follows the systematic terminology used in chemistry classrooms and laboratories. On the other, “sodium bicarbonate” lands on most consumer packaging and recipe books. Chemically and practically, both names represent the same substance. The IUPAC, or International Union of Pure and Applied Chemistry, officially prefers "sodium hydrogen carbonate,” but decades of baking tradition and product marketing have kept “sodium bicarbonate” in regular use.

The Science and the Practical Side

Anyone who has watched a volcano science project in action already knows the fizzy reaction that makes sodium bicarbonate special. Combined with acidic ingredients (think vinegar or lemon juice), it releases carbon dioxide bubbles. This property not only brings cakes to life in the oven but also helps clean grimy kitchen sinks, keep refrigerators odor-free, and manage minor indigestion as an antacid.

Some confusion comes from the term "bicarbonate." It was coined early on, before systematic chemical naming rules were set, and stuck around because it rolls off the tongue more easily for most people. The “hydrogen carbonate” label points out the same hydrogen atom, just with a modern twist. So, reading “sodium hydrogen carbonate” on a packet shouldn’t scare off a home baker. It works exactly the same way as the box of baking soda tucked in the fridge.

The Importance of Clear Labels

Mislabelling or inconsistent chemical names can trip up shoppers and even professionals. I once overheard a pharmacy customer ask for “baking soda” by its street name and the staff brought out both sodium carbonate (washing soda) and sodium bicarbonate. Mixing these up in the kitchen or medicine cabinet could mean a ruined cake or, much worse, a harmful mistake when used as an antacid. The U.S. Food and Drug Administration and other regulatory agencies encourage manufacturers to standardize names on packaging, but old habits and market familiarity tend to linger.
